			<description><![CDATA[<p>There is no jackpot for Michigan Rolldown.  If some one matches all 5 numbers they usually get around 13-15k.  No if no one matches all five numbers then the money that would be used to pay the match 5 winner is split up between all those that match 4.  Drawings are at 7:29 and that cut off time to purchase tickets is at 7:08.  With odds of 1:7 i like Rolldown too.</p>]]></description>
